Korean War in American English
the war (1950-53) between the Korean People's Democratic Republic (North Korea) and the Republic of Korea (South Korea), which ended in an inconclusive cease-fire: the U.S. and other United Nations countries participated on the side of South Korea noun: the war, begun on June 25, 1950, between North Korea, aided by Communist China, and South Korea, aided by the United States and other United Nations members forming a United Nations armed force: truce signed July 27, 1953 Korean War in British English noun: the war (1950–53) fought between North Korea, aided by Communist China, and South Korea, supported by the US and other members of the UN |
